Product Description

Real Estate Office Management: A Guide to Success takes a concise look at contemporary real estate office management covering the essential day-to-day knowledge needed to successfully operate the office. It exclusively focuses on the highly essential "operational" issues that a person would encounter from the initial planning stages through the eventual sale of the office. The content uses numerous real world examples, from the author's experience, to demonstrate how to best handle making critical decisions.

About the Author
Bob Herd, CRB (Certified Residential Brokerage Manager), CRS, (Council for Residential Specialists), ABR, GRI has significant experience in real estate office management. His first management position was in 1974 in Burlingame, CA. Next, he opened his own company, a Century 21 franchise in 1974 and earned every honor that Century 21 offered over the next several years and quickly became the office preference in the north peninsula. He later sold the company in the mid 80's and began working as a branch manager for one of the larger residential firms on the peninsula eventually managing over 84 sales associates at one time. Bob currently works ffor Coldwell Banker Success Southwest.

Before I set up my own brokerage, I interviewed many broker owners. I found most of the broker owners didn't devote their efforts in effective recruiting. Most of the brokerages do not grow with the industry. The number of their sales persons didn't increase but decrease. Only a few broker owners spend their time in effective recruiting and training. There is one brokerage with many brand new agents come in. But 2 years later, many of those agents moved to other brokerages. This brokerage becomes a training camp for other brokerages. There is one broker owner spends lots of efforts in recruiting, but some experienced agents, mega agents moved out due to the broker owner is too much busy on recruiting without taking care of those top agents.
This is the best book for broker owners. The book is simple, easy to read and hits the key points without lengthy wordings. recruiting agents, retaining top agents, training, marketing... all the keys are here. Those broker owners who want to be a leader in the industry should read this book, and implement the skills, knowledge of this book into real life to be successful.
